What Are the Common QC Checkpoints?
Quality control in the manufacturing process typically involves three key checkpoints:
-
Incoming Quality Control (IQC): This initial inspection ensures that raw materials meet the required specifications before they are used in production. Materials are tested for safety, durability, and compliance with relevant standards.
-
In-Process Quality Control (IPQC): During production, ongoing inspections are conducted to monitor the assembly process and ensure that each doll is being manufactured according to established quality standards. This may include checking stitching, stuffing, and component assembly.
-
Final Quality Control (FQC): Once the dolls are completed, they undergo a final inspection to check for defects and ensure that they meet both aesthetic and safety standards. Random sampling may be used for this stage to verify quality across batches.

Comprehensive Cost and Pricing Analysis for elf on the shelf doll Sourcing
What Are the Key Cost Components in Sourcing Elf on the Shelf Dolls?
When sourcing Elf on the Shelf dolls, understanding the cost structure is essential for international B2B buyers. The primary cost components include:
-
Materials: High-quality fabrics, stuffing, and safety components are vital for producing plush dolls. Sustainable and certified materials can increase costs but may be necessary for compliance with international safety standards.
-
Labor: The cost of labor varies significantly by region. Countries with lower labor costs might offer competitive pricing, but this can impact quality. Ensure that the workforce is trained adequately to maintain high production standards.
-
Manufacturing Overhead: This includes expenses related to factory operations such as utilities, rent, and administrative costs. Factories with efficient processes may have lower overhead, which can be a deciding factor in pricing.
-
Tooling: Initial setup costs for manufacturing tooling and molds can be substantial. However, these costs are typically amortized over large production runs, making bulk orders more cost-effective.
-
Quality Control (QC): Investing in robust QC processes can prevent costly recalls and enhance brand reputation. International buyers should ensure that suppliers have proper QC certifications.
-
Logistics: Shipping costs can vary dramatically based on the origin of the goods, chosen Incoterms, and shipping method. Air freight is faster but more expensive compared to sea freight, which may be more suitable for large orders.
-
Margin: Suppliers typically add a margin to cover their costs and profit. Understanding the competitive landscape can help buyers gauge whether the margin is reasonable.

What Are Common Trade Terminology and Jargon Used in the Elf on the Shelf Doll Industry?
Familiarity with industry-specific terminology can help B2B buyers navigate negotiations and contracts more effectively. Here are several key terms to know:
-
O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
This term refers to companies that produce products based on the designs and specifications of another company. In the context of Elf on the Shelf dolls, buyers may work with OEMs to create unique doll designs or packaging, allowing for brand differentiation. -
M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ity)
MOQ is the smallest number of units a supplier is willing to sell. Understanding MOQ is crucial for B2B buyers, as it can affect inventory management and cash flow. Suppliers may set MOQs based on production costs and capacity, so negotiating favorable terms can lead to better purchasing strategies. -
RFQ (Request for Quotation)
An RFQ is a document sent to suppliers to request pricing and terms for a specific quantity of goods. B2B buyers should use RFQs to gather competitive pricing for Elf on the Shelf dolls, enabling informed decision-making when selecting suppliers. -
Incoterms (International Commercial Terms)
Incoterms are a set of internationally recognized rules that define the responsibilities of buyers and sellers in international trade. Familiarity with terms such as FOB (Free on Board) or C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) is essential for B2B buyers to understand shipping obligations and costs associated with importing Elf on the Shelf dolls. -
Lead Time
Lead time refers to the time taken from placing an order to receiving the goods. For B2B buyers, understanding lead times is crucial for inventory planning and ensuring timely availability of products, especially during peak seasons like Christmas. -
Quality Assurance (QA)
QA refers to the systematic processes that ensure products meet specified quality standards. Implementing effective QA measures is vital for maintaining product integrity and customer satisfaction, particularly for toys marketed to children.

What Is the Historical Context of the Elf on the Shelf Doll for B2B Buyers?
The Elf on the Shelf doll has its roots in a Christmas tradition that originated in the United States in the early 2000s. The concept centers around a scout elf that observes children’s behavior and reports back to Santa Claus. This tradition quickly gained popularity, resulting in the commercialization of the dolls alongside a storybook that narrates the elf’s adventures. The initial success of the Elf on the Shelf concept paved the way for a range of related products, including various themed dolls and accessories, which are now widely available across international markets.
